Intravenous anesthetics are drugs administered parenterally to induce anesthesia or sedation. Propofol is a widely used agent formulated as a 1% emulsion in soybean oil, glycerol, and egg phosphatide. It induces rapid anesthesia primarily due to its rapid distribution from the bloodstream to target tissues and is metabolized in the liver. However, it can cause significant pain on injection and hypertriglyceridemia. Fospropofol, a water-based prodrug of propofol, lacks these adverse effects.

Conscious Sedation: Decision-making in the Borderline Cases.

Ashwin Rao1, Steven Jl Rodrigues2, Sivakumar Nuvvula3

  • 1Department of Pediatric and Preventive Dentistry, Manipal College of Dental Sciences, Mangaluru, Manipal Academy of Higher Education, Manipal, Karnataka, India.

International Journal of Clinical Pediatric Dentistry
|January 9, 2026
PubMed
Summary

This guide helps clinicians choose behavior management strategies for children, including nonpharmacological methods, moderate sedation, or general anesthesia, based on behavior and procedure length.

Area of Science:

  • Pediatric Dentistry
  • Behavioral Management
  • Conscious Sedation

Background:

  • Clinicians often hesitate to use moderate sedation until a child exhibits hysterical behavior, which is not its intended use.
  • Accurate assessment of child behavior and procedure length is crucial for effective management.

Purpose of the Study:

  • To provide clinicians with a framework for selecting appropriate behavior management strategies for pediatric dental patients.
  • To guide decision-making regarding nonpharmacological behavior guidance, moderate sedation, deep sedation, and general anesthesia.

Main Methods:

  • Utilizing Frankl's behavior rating scale to classify child behavior.
  • Assessing the intended length of the dental procedure.
  • Integrating behavior classification and procedure length to determine the management strategy.

Main Results:

  • A systematic approach enables predictable and confident decision-making in child behavior management.
  • Frankl's scale and procedure duration are key criteria for selecting sedation or guidance techniques.

Conclusions:

  • Behavior guidance techniques should be evidence-based, not arbitrary.
  • Proper classification of behavior and procedure length facilitates optimal patient management and sedation decisions.
